Demarcation of roads and other assets are based on the Road Management Act Code of Practice “Operational Responsibility for Public Roads” (May 2017). For specific areas where this code does not provide a definitive answer and for areas that Council wants to maintain to a higher standard than VicRoads there will be individual agreements made.
